The colloid gas aphrons(CGA) are microfoams produced by high-speed agitated the surfactant. This issue studied the preparation method of CGA by anion surfactant, improved on the CGA forther, separately reviewed these effective ingredients such as the concentration of SDS, the speed of agitate, the time of agitate and preparation temperature and so on, which mainly effect the stability and gassy rate. The experiment result showing that the main ingredients effected CGA's half life and CGA's gas hold-up were the concentration of SDS and the speed of agitate, and the finer condition of preparation SDS was CSDS: 2.336g/L, agitate speed: 6400r/min, agitate time: 3 min.This issue puts forward a new the combination of CGA and cyclone-staticmicrobubble column to treat with Cu( â…¡) in the waste water. The laboratory columnseparation model which corresponds with cyclone-static microbubble column was setup. Effects of pH the concentration of Cu(â…¡), the dosage of SDS , the work pressure of cycle pump of the column and medicament of flocculation on the flotation separation were studied in this issue, and colligating each operation parameter make out the orthogonal experiment of the flotation separation of Cu( â…¡) by fractional factorial, while the concentration of Cu(â…¡) 100mg/L, the dosage of flocculation 5mg, we can get a better operation parameter pH10, SDS1.1680g, pressure0.12MPa, the final removal efficiency of the Cu(â…¡) in the waste water reach 99%. According to the magnitude of extreme difference, the primary and secondary sequence of the three ingredients were pH, the dosage of SDS, the work pressure of cycle pump of the column.This issue discussed the mechanism of CGA-column flotation, and discussed the separation course of cyclone-static microbubble column, it concluded that the principle of flotation colurmn, the principle and course of selfinduction, pipe flotation and mineralization of microfoams, the liquid state of column separation stage, the principle of cyclone stage dynamics separation and strengthen the mechanism of cycle recovery of column. This issue analyze the liquid dynamics state of the compound matter Cu( II )-microfoams, and analyze the stability of microfoams and the state of the compound matter Cu(II)- microfoams going up in the water, and discussed the mechanism of CGA , Cu(â…¡) adhering to microfoams, and also discuss the course of pH , the concentration of Cu(â…¡) effect flotation.According to the theory analysis and experiment, CGA-column flotation method treading the waste-water containing Cu(â…¡) receives better effect, it is anew technology of dealing with waster water, which has wide foreground.
